ATAPI Units Page
This option concerns about mass storage devices using a standard EIDE interface.
The CPU board has two EIDE controllers, so the ATAPI Units can be separated in two parts:
ATAPI Primary and ATAPI Secondary. In any case the options are the same.
Note: ATAPI (or EIDE) devices can be both hard disks and CD_ROM devices or, sometimes,
storage tape-units.
Note: each EIDE interface supports two peripherals, called master unit and slave unit.
Remember to select as master unit a bootable disk (containing any valid O.S.).
